connectionmonitoring/connmon/connectionmonitor/inc/ConnMonSess.h
changeset 71 9f263f780e41
parent 0 5a93021fdf25
equal deleted inserted replaced
70:ac5daea24fb0 71:9f263f780e41
     1 /*
     1 /*
     2 * Copyright (c) 2002-2009 Nokia Corporation and/or its subsidiary(-ies).
     2 * Copyright (c) 2002-2010 Nokia Corporation and/or its subsidiary(-ies).
     3 * All rights reserved.
     3 * All rights reserved.
     4 * This component and the accompanying materials are made available
     4 * This component and the accompanying materials are made available
     5 * under the terms of "Eclipse Public License v1.0"
     5 * under the terms of "Eclipse Public License v1.0"
     6 * which accompanies this distribution, and is available
     6 * which accompanies this distribution, and is available
     7 * at the URL "http://www.eclipse.org/legal/epl-v10.html".
     7 * at the URL "http://www.eclipse.org/legal/epl-v10.html".
   345      * @return KErrNone if successfull, otherwise a system wide error code.
   345      * @return KErrNone if successfull, otherwise a system wide error code.
   346      */
   346      */
   347     TInt SetBoolAttribute();
   347     TInt SetBoolAttribute();
   348 
   348 
   349     /**
   349     /**
       
   350      * Sets the TBool attribute asynchronously to the server (KConnectionStop
       
   351      * & KConnectionStopAll).
       
   352      * @return KRequestPending if request initiated successfully, otherwise a
       
   353      * system wide error code.
       
   354      */
       
   355     TInt SetAsyncBoolAttributeL();
       
   356 
       
   357     /**
   350      * Sets the String attribute to the server.
   358      * Sets the String attribute to the server.
   351      * @return KErrNone if successfull, otherwise a system wide error code.
   359      * @return KErrNone if successfull, otherwise a system wide error code.
   352      */
   360      */
   353     TInt SetStringAttributeL();
   361     TInt SetStringAttributeL();
   354 
   362